We're hiring an EHS Consultant to develop, implement and enhance EHS programs to ensure a safe and compliant work environment for our client. You'll support, develop, communicate safety criteria, assist with training, maintain safety standards, and proactively identify areas of improvement to mitigate risks. Key Responsibilities:

  • Conduct thorough assessments of working conditions, focusing on occupational health hazards and compliance with OSHA regulations.
  • Promote EHS awareness through effective communication and employee engagement strategies.
  • Execute sampling plans and conduct risk assessments for new processes and equipment.
  • Serve as the primary point of contact for safety and environmental issues, ensuring timely resolution and compliance.
  • Support EHS audits, develop action plans, job hazard analyses and drive continual improvement efforts to reduce site EHS risks.
  • Maintain accurate metrics and reporting systems to monitor EHS performance and compliance.
  • Provide guidance on ergonomics, chemical inventory management, and waste inspections.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to integrate EHS into daily operations and drive best practices.
  • Support training and development initiatives to enhance EHS knowledge and compliance.
Basic Qualifications:
  • Bachelor’s degree or higher in industrial hygiene, occupational health, environmental engineering, or related field.
  • 3-10 years’ experience in EHS support, preferably in the manufacturing and/or aerospace sector.
  • Knowledge of OSHA regulations, specifically 29 CFR 1910.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Word and Excel.
  • Ability to maintain confidentiality in matters involving security and personnel issues.
Preferred Qualifications:
  • Certification such as ASP, CSP, NEBOSH, CIH, or CHMM.
  • Strong communication, teamwork, and analytical skills.
  • Experience in emergency response and workers compensation case management.
  • Familiarity with environmental regulations (CAA, RCRA, CWA).
  • Experience with 5S programs and developing safety training materials.
